Father of Pembroke Park shooting victims says son died trying to save mother, siblings from gunman

PEMBROKE PARK, Fla. – It’s a double dose of unimaginable pain for Kelvin Solomon.

Both of Solomon’s children, 11-year-old Xion and 8-year-old Phiinyx, were among six people shot Wednesday night in a family tragedy.

“It’s hard to really put it into words,” he said. “I just lost my son, my daughter is fighting for her life right now.”

His daughter Phiinyx is the only victim who survived.

“She’s doing a lot better,” said Solomon. “It’s still touch and go right now, but we’re just staying at her side right now and hoping for the best.”

The children’s mother, 32-year-old Julie Cruz, was killed after investigators say her partner, 34-year-old Stephen McKenzie, opened fire on his family inside of the couple’s Pembroke Park apartment building.

Detectives believe McKenzie then shot his own two sons, Nova and Emery, both just 2 years old, killing them both.

And then, according to police, he shot their other siblings, critically injuring Phiinyx and killing Xion, who were from a previous relationship between Solomon and Cruz, all before turning the gun on himself.

“My son was very brave in trying to protect and shield his mother and his siblings from this cowardly attack,” said Solomon. “She was definitely on her way out of the situation, so that could possibly be the deciding factor into what just happened.”

A domestic violence tragedy that has robbed the world of four young shining lights. Solomon said Xion excelled at sports.

“Football player, good kid, very big heart and actually he just won the championship in the sports league right here,” said Solomon.
